Emerson, GA - The Knights baseball team was on the road Friday and Saturday as they traveled to Lakepoint Sports Complex in Emerson, Georgia to take part in the 2022 Southeast Rumble, hosted by Reinhardt University. The Knights were set to take on three teams; Columbia International University, Indiana Tech, and Tennessee Wesleyan University. Each team was named in the preseason NAIA poll with Tennessee Wesleyan ranked the highest at 5th and the other two teams receiving votes. The Knights would take on the Rams of Columbia International University on Friday night. The Knights would be the away team at the neutral site and would start the scoring off in the first inning as
Ryan Wilson would hit a two-run home run, his first of the season. The Knights would score two more runs in the top of the second inning on RBI singles by
Justin Brooks and
Blake Metcalfe as the Knights would take a 4-0 lead after two innings. The Knights would increase their lead in the fourth inning on a two-run home run from Rafael Gomez Jr and an RBI single from
Clayton Smith. The Knights would continue their offensive onslaught with another two runs in the fifth inning with a Metcalfe two-run double and the Knights would hold a 9-0 lead over the Rams. The Rams would score three runs in the bottom of the fifth inning but the scoring would end as neither team would score any more runs in the game and the Knights would take a 9-3 win. The win would be the 500th career win for Coach
Paul Knight as a coach of a 4-year institution. The Knights would return to Lakepoint Sports Complex on Saturday as they would take on the Warriors of Indiana Tech. The Knights would fall behind early as the Warriors would score two runs in the top of the second inning but the Knights would answer back in the bottom half of the inning with two runs, one scoring via an error on the Warriors catcher and a
JT Rice RBI groundout. The Warriors would score runs in the third and fourth innings and the Knights would be down 4-2. The Knights would find their offense in the fifth inning as they would score two runs on a Brooks RBI groundout and a
Brian Herrera RBI single. The game would remain tied at 4-4 until the bottom of the eighth inning as the Knights would get an RBI single from
Paolo Brossier and a walk by Gomez Jr with the bases loaded to give the Knights a 6-4 lead.
Caleb Lanoux would be credited with the win after coming in the get the last out of the eighth inning before closing out the game in the ninth inning. The Knights would have one more game to play as it would be their toughest of the three games as they would take on the Bulldogs of Tennessee Wesleyan University. The Knights would have a tough time doing anything offensively as they would not get their first hit of the game until the fourth inning on a
Derick Stager single. The Bulldogs would score their first run in the fifth inning and the Knights would trail 1-0. A leadoff single by Metcalfe would get the sixth inning started for the Knights but three straight outs would not produce any runs. The Bulldogs would score two more runs in the bottom of the sixth and another in the eighth as the Knights would not get any more hits and the Knights would lose 4-0.
